Disability shower installation services involve customizing and installing accessible shower setups designed to meet the needs of individ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These installations often include features such as low-threshold or curbless ent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ip surfaces to enhance safety and independence. Service providers work with property owners to select appropriate fixtures and ensure the installation complies with accessibility standards, creating a safer and more functional bathing environment.
These services address common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ty entering traditional showers, increased risk of slips and falls, and challenges in maintaining independence during daily routines. By installing accessible showers, property owners can improve safety, reduce the need for assistance, and promote a more comfortable bathing experience. Properly installed disability showers can also help prevent accidents and injuries, making them an important upgrade for homes and facilities serving individuals with mobility needs.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Waunakee,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. Basic installations may be closer to the lower end, while custom features increase expenses.
Material Expenses - The price of shower materials can vary from $300 to $2,000. Standard options like acrylic or fiberglass tend to be more affordable, while specialized or custom tiles can raise costs.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ing a disability shower often fall between $500 and $2,500. The total depends on the existing plumbing setup and any necessary modifications to accommodate accessibility features.
Additional Costs - Extra features such as grab bars, seating, or non-slip flooring may add $200 to $1,000 to the overall cost. These upgrades enhance safety and accessibility but can influence the final price.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
